How they compare
Eastern Africa currently reports 64,638 1000 USD against 26,289 1000 USD in Finland, a difference of 38,349 1000 USD.
That makes Eastern Africa's figure about 2.5 times Finland's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 43 shared years of data; in 1966 it was Eastern Africa ahead.
Eastern Africa ranks 20th and Finland ranks 23rd of 33 groups.
Eastern Africa has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Eastern Africa | Finland |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 1,676 1000 USD | 50.5 1000 USD | 1,625 1000 USD | Eastern Africa |
| 1970s | 4,899 1000 USD | 63.86 1000 USD | 4,835 1000 USD | Eastern Africa |
| 1980s | 15,148 1000 USD | 0 1000 USD | 15,148 1000 USD | Eastern Africa |
| 1990s | 20,097 1000 USD | 11,751 1000 USD | 8,345 1000 USD | Eastern Africa |
| 2000s | 49,488 1000 USD | 35,359 1000 USD | 14,129 1000 USD | Eastern Africa |
| 2010s | 94,952 1000 USD | 32,336 1000 USD | 62,616 1000 USD | Eastern Africa |
| 2020s | 64,129 1000 USD | 24,194 1000 USD | 39,935 1000 USD | Eastern Africa |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
